Because stocks are three times more volatile than bonds, the amount of risk in a portfolio is determined by that 3:1 … WebSay you set your portfolio to be 80% stocks, 15% bonds and 5% cash. If you reinvest the dividends from your stocks, you'll eventually end up with a higher proportion in stocks than the 80% you started out with. Not to mention the fact that you'll probably want to change your asset allocation as you age and your goals change.
